Mofongo

Mofongo

Mofongo is a flavorful dish made from mashed fried green plantains, often mixed with garlic, chicharrón (fried pork skin), and served with a savory broth. Its popularity in Wilkes-Barre stems from the Dominican community's love for this hearty comfort food, often enjoyed during family gatherings. Pernil

Pernil

Pernil is a succulent slow-roasted pork shoulder, marinated with garlic, oregano, and citrus juices, resulting in a crispy skin and tender meat. This dish is a staple in Dominican celebrations, making it a beloved choice in Wilkes-Barre where community festivities often highlight traditional cuisine. Sancocho

Sancocho

Sancocho is a hearty stew made with various meats and root vegetables, simmered to perfection with herbs and spices. This dish is particularly popular in Wilkes-Barre during colder months, as it's known for its warming qualities and communal appeal.
